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it c3b8968c authored by Glenn Kasten's avatar Glenn Kasten Committed by android-build-merger
Browse files

Merge \\"Restore old signature for acquire/release session\\" into nyc-dev am: ef9cab1d

am: 20ca8a71

Change-Id: Iafa989fcaab7678cfc5b4d6305322591e717caa3
parents fcde3a93 20ca8a71
Loading
Loading
Loading
Loading
+4 −0
Original line number Diff line number Diff line
@@ -160,6 +160,10 @@ public:
    static void acquireAudioSessionId(audio_session_t audioSession, pid_t pid);
    static void releaseAudioSessionId(audio_session_t audioSession, pid_t pid);

    // FIXME remove
    static void acquireAudioSessionId(int audioSession, pid_t pid);
    static void releaseAudioSessionId(int audioSession, pid_t pid);

    // Get the HW synchronization source used for an audio session.
    // Return a valid source or AUDIO_HW_SYNC_INVALID if an error occurs
    // or no HW sync source is used.
+12 −0
Original line number Diff line number Diff line
@@ -417,6 +417,18 @@ void AudioSystem::releaseAudioSessionId(audio_session_t audioSession, pid_t pid)
    }
}

// FIXME remove
void AudioSystem::acquireAudioSessionId(int audioSession, pid_t pid)
{
    acquireAudioSessionId((audio_session_t) audioSession, pid);
}

// FIXME remove
void AudioSystem::releaseAudioSessionId(int audioSession, pid_t pid)
{
    releaseAudioSessionId((audio_session_t) audioSession, pid);
}

audio_hw_sync_t AudioSystem::getAudioHwSyncForSession(audio_session_t sessionId)
{
    const sp<IAudioFlinger>& af = AudioSystem::get_audio_flinger();